A.A collegiate athletic association shall not and shall not authorize its member institutions to: 1. Prevent a student athlete at a postsecondary institution from earning compensation for the use of his or her name, image, or likeness; 2. Penalize a student athlete or prevent a student athlete from full participation in an intercollegiate sport because he or she obtains professional representation or receives assistance with services associated with name, image, or likeness activities including with contracts or other legal matters from an individual, entity, or a postsecondary institution; or 3. Legislative History

Added by Laws 2023, c. 315, § 6, emerg. eff. May 26, 2023. Amended by Laws 2024, c. 85, § 3, emerg. eff. April 22, 2024.
